HOPENHAYN, Martín. "Faúndez" and other texts . rev.estud.soc. [online]. 2006, n.24, pp.45-51. ISSN 0123-885X.
The author presents short texts, essay-like, on different subjects. He first criticizes consumer society in a world that every day is more into technological terms and virtual interactions; then approaches the meaning of love for humanity, to later analyze sickness and criticize the moral segregation of victims; inspired by Borges, he turns to a series of considerations on the creation and destiny phenomena, as well as giving a thought to the issue of global inequality, based on statistical analysis. By referring to the freedom of personality speech that floats in the environment, he presents the Puritanism existing in San Francisco; then points out several ideas on the actual need of assessing everything. A series of aphorisms is also included.
Keywords : Humanity; sickness; creation; consumer society; aphorisms.
